The Artist at Work

Outlett's current single "Say Goodbye" is currently being aired on the world Famous KROQ in Los Angeles where the band headlined the KROQ Micro Brew Festival in Los Angeles. Outlett has opened for such national acts as Motley Crüe and Aerosmith and toured with Powerman 5000. The group gigged with the Warped Tour two years running. At Tom Morello's invitation, Chastity played her djembe with Alice In Chains and Cypress Hill at the CD release party for Morello's "The Nightwatchman." Outlett has been showered with numerous awards, including Rock Artist of the Year and Rock Artist of The Year in the Los Angeles Music Awards and many more. A best video prize was awarded by Unsigned Music Magazine in and other publications have lauded the band, as well. The group has also been touted as best live band in the Orange County Music Awards. The Independent Artist Registry declared Outlett one of the Best Unsigned bands in the nation. Music Connection Magazine also awarded Outlett as one of the Hot 100 Best Unsigned Bands in the nation two years in a row. Outlett nabbed a licensing deal with Ultrashort Media, as well. Work is wrapping up on Outlet's new CD, which is due out in January 2009. The group is currently working with A&R Select, the world's leading artist development firm, based out of Los Angeles.
